Ferrotitanium Producers and Uses

   Although it can also be created directly from titanium mineral concentrates, ferrotitanium is often created by induction melting titanium scrap with iron or steel. Ferro Titanium is often found in grades of 30% and 70% Ti. Uses of ferrotitanium  In the process of making steel, ferro titanium is utilised as a deoxidizing and degassing element. Ferro Titanium has a fundamentally preferred deoxidizing limit over silicon or manganese. Due to the metal's increased strength and corrosion resistance, Ferro Titanium significantly improves the mechanical properties of steel.
